Shropshire Avenue Homicide Investigation Arrest

UPDATE - 04/30/24: One person has been arrested in connection with the shooting death of Devin Chenault, 37, that occurred just after midnight.

Jerrico Roberts, 36, was arrested and is currently being held at the Fayette County Detention Center on the below charges. In addition to the charges from the homicide, he was also charged on unrelated warrants.

  • Murder
  •  Assault 2nd degree – Domestic Violence
  • Tampering with physical evidence
  • Possession of a handgun by convicted felon

 

During the investigation, detectives learned that the shooting may have taken place in the 1800 block of Liberty Road.

The Lexington Police Department is investigating a homicide that occurred on April 30, 2024.  

On Tuesday, April 30, 2024, around 12:25 a.m., an officer in the area of Shropshire Avenue and East Third Street located a vehicle blocking the intersection. When the officer approached the vehicle, they located a male victim suffering from a gunshot wound. The victim was pronounced deceased at the scene.

The Fayette County Coroner’s Office will release the decedent’s name.
